The Uttar Pradesh Police Recruitment Board has announced a rescheduled date for the UP Police Constable Recruitment Exam following a paper leak incident on February 18-19, 2024. The revised exam dates are August 23, 24, 25, 30, and 31, 2024. This decision affects approximately 48 lakh candidates who had applied for the exam.

Key Points:

  • Rescheduled Exam Dates: The exam will now take place over five days in August, with two shifts each day. Each shift will accommodate 5 lakh candidates.
  • Positions Available: The recruitment drive aims to fill 60,244 constable positions across the state.

Measures and Public Assistance:

  • New Integrity Measures: In response to the leak, the board has implemented stringent measures to ensure the integrity of the upcoming examination.
  • Public Reporting: A notice posted on August 5 calls for public assistance in reporting any suspicious activities related to the exam. This includes paper leaks, cheating, and other fraudulent activities. Information can be reported anonymously via email at satarkta.policeboard@gmail.com or through WhatsApp at 9454457951. The board assures confidentiality for those providing information.

Consequences for Fraudulent Activities:

  • Severe Penalties: The board warns that those involved in fraudulent activities, such as paper leaks or cheating, face severe penalties including life imprisonment and fines up to Rs 1 crore.

The UP Police Recruitment Board emphasizes its commitment to a fair examination process and seeks public support in safeguarding the integrity of the recruitment drive.
